Filing History

IRS 990 filing history for Greater Hot Springs Chamber Of Commerce showing financial trends over 13 years of public records:

Over 13 years of IRS 990 filings (2011–2023), Greater Hot Springs Chamber Of Commerce's revenue has grown by 24.8%, moving from $890K to $1.1M. Total assets increased by 13.1% over the same period, from $536K to $606K. Total functional expenses rose by 3.8%, from $971K to $1.0M. In its most recent filing year (2023), Greater Hot Springs Chamber Of Commerce reported a surplus of $102K, with revenue exceeding expenses. The organization holds $56K in liabilities against $606K in assets (debt-to-asset ratio: 9.3%), resulting in net assets of $550K.

IRS 990 forms are annual information returns that most tax-exempt organizations must file with the IRS. These forms provide detailed financial information including revenue, expenses, assets, liabilities, and compensation of officers.
